From 64b6b5d2a7b81bcad3f0a50a6c1556fd7300c171 Mon Sep 17 00:00:00 2001 From: =?UTF-8?q?Daniel=20Ekl=C3=B6f?= Date: Mon, 26 Jun 2023 17:55:04 +0200 Subject: [PATCH] =?UTF-8?q?config:=20dpi-aware:=20remove=20=E2=80=98auto?= =?UTF-8?q?=E2=80=99=20value,=20and=20default=20to=20=E2=80=98no=E2=80=99?= MIME-Version: 1.0 Content-Type: text/plain; charset=UTF-8 Content-Transfer-Encoding: 8bit We now default to scaling fonts using the scaling factor, not monitor DPI. The ‘auto’ value for dpi-aware has been removed.
